Handover Note — Revised Sales-Commission Scheme

For the board: responsibility for the revised commission scheme transfers from Director Pellane to Director Varrow effective month-end. The new tiers for the Lindover territory are approved; payout modelling for the Castrel range is complete and filed. No open disputes remain. The confidential note on business plans follows directly below.

internal memo for kagef-yawif: Only 3 of the 91 pilot accounts renewed Aldeth, so a churn review is set for April 18. Gilionix Freight is in early talks to buy Quenmirox Works for about $450.7 million.

## Onboarding: Reset Flow Revamp (Project Windrow)

The new password reset flow replaces emailed tokens with short-lived signed links. Token state, attempt counters, and lockout records live in the `resets` schema. All writes are audited; review the trigger definitions before approving. To inspect the schema yourself, connect to the review replica with the following string.

warehouse DSN: mssql://rusdor_svc:0FSWCn9@db-951a.paliqforge.local:5432/ulawyn

## Kiosk Watchdog (Pebblekiosk v4)

Support crew: the Pebblekiosk watchdog restarts the shell app if it stops heartbeating for 90 seconds. Most "frozen kiosk" tickets from the Larkmoor mall units are actually the watchdog doing its job slowly, so give it two minutes before escalating. If a unit boot-loops, check that the watchdog can phone home to the telemetry relay — it won't start supervising without a valid relay credential. On a fresh image, open the kiosk's env file and add this line:

env line for yahip-tafog: RELAY_SECRET3=4ca

Please review staffing rosters carefully; demonstration units arrive two weeks prior and must be installed per the merchandising guide from Elsa Tarn's team. Training modules are mandatory for all floor staff before launch day. Regional pricing remains uniform, with a limited introductory bundle in the first month only. Report readiness status through your district coordinators by the stated deadline. The confidential planning note follows directly below.

confidential, bawig-bajeg: Headcount on the Oliix team goes from 5 to 80 by the end of January. Gross margin on Oliix came in at 10 percent against a plan of 20 percent.